Andrew H. Leung

Home Page: https://anihaus.com/


Andrew “Drew” Leung is a Los Angeles-based artist, filmmaker, and concept designer for Anihaus Inc. He is the director of the animated short documentary “The Chemical Factory,"  now a LA Times Short Doc. His more recent commercial work includes feature films like Wakanda Forever, The Black Panther, Lord of the Rings: Rings of Power, and Mulan. Leung had his start in the film industry as a matte painter for Sky Captain and the World of Tomorrow. His varied past in visual effects and feature animation brings special insight into story-driven design and world-building. Leung has received a Certificate of Appreciation from the Art Directors Guild for Oscar-winning movies La La Land and Black Panther and has appeared in multiple publications of Spectrum Fantastic Art. He is also a lecturer at the University of California, Los Angeles, School of Theatre, Film, and Television. He is also a member of the Academy of Motion Pictures and Sciences Production Design branch. When he's not at his desk, he's a father and motorcyclist.
